[i]New manager Luis Enrique may not have the club exactly where he wants it to be at this point, but he has been working. The tactics at the Camp Nou have begun to change, and in some ways it is already paying off in a big way.
Granted, Barcelona’s style of football will never truly disappear, but Enrique has been right to make a few necessary alterations to a game plan that opponents have had figured out for a few years now.
Just how has Enrique changed Barcelona tactically? Let’s break it down.

Defensive Changes
As should be the case, Enrique’s biggest tactical changes have come on the defensive end of the ball. Though the back line is still having a lot of the same problems as the last few seasons, there has been a bit of improvement.
To begin with, this season has seen the Blaugrana full-backs do a much better job of timing their forward runs.
In seasons gone by, Dani Alves and Jordi Alba would both launch into attack at the same time and leave the back line absolutely unguarded. This led to countless counterattacks, which did Barcelona in a plenty of occasions.
This year, those runs may still be present, but there is a lot more planning behind them. Rarely will you see both full-backs up in attack at the same time, and that alone has given the defense more help when matched up against fast opposing forwards.
There are still the moments of weakness where the full-backs do get caught out of position, but it is clear that Enrique has emphasized timing the forward runs in order to ensure that the back line is not left exposed.

Additionally, Enrique has changed Barcelona’s zonal marking style of set piece defending for one that focuses on man defending. This ensures that every attack is marked rather than a zone, and the change has already paid off.
According to Squawka.com , Barcelona has only conceded two headed goals in all competitions this season, which seems unreal based on the last few campaigns.
Despite the alterations, the defense is still struggling with individual errors and marking counterattacks. The back line has a long way to go before they can be truly relied upon, but it is hard to doubt that Lucho hasn't brought some much-needed adjustments with his return to the Camp Nou.

Midfield Changes

Barcelona’s midfield unit has been relatively untouched for well over five years now. The trio of Xavi, Andres Iniesta and Sergio Busquets has been immensely successful together, and changing that can almost be seen as blasphemy in Catalonia.
However, with age playing a factor, Enrique needed to touch up the middle of the park for the Catalan giants this season.
The first change that was initially made was focusing on more direct attacking. The days of endless and pointless passing behind the forwards are nearly gone as the midfield is now looking to attack quicker than this squad ever has.
Busquets and Xavi can be seen making more decisive passes than ever to set up their teammates in attack, while Iniesta has become even more dangerous with the ball at his feet.
But the Barcelona midfield trio has gone under some rebuilding as well. All three of the stars have played less minutes to this point than in previous years, and while that can somewhat be linked to injuries, the biggest reason is the presence of other talented players in the middle of the park.

Ivan Rakitic has already seen plenty of playing time and has even changed the midfield dynamic. His ability to be a scoring threat on his own has revamped the midfield attack, while his ability to drop deep and defend has given the Barcelona back line more coverage than they have normally been afforded in recent years.

However, the biggest change of all in the middle of park is the fact that there has been a revitalized focus on defending.
Xavi and Iniesta have never been defensive players. They have had a few big moments in defense, but Barcelona has never been able to rely on them to consistently give the back line coverage unless the entire team was pressing as a unit.
With Rakitic and Rafinha seeing more time, Busquets now has help in front of the defense, and it is helping the back line become more solid. In truth, their ability to play as box-to-box midfielders has given Barcelona vastly more diversity, and the club is all the better because of it.
Mix in more direct attacking with a commitment to defending, and the Barcelona midfield is looking strong. There could, of course, be much more improvement, but the tactics are looking up.
